Description:
Nitrosomorpholine is a chemical compound classified as a nitrosamine, which is formed by the reaction of morpholine with nitrous acid. It is characterized by its molecular formula C4H8N2O and has a molecular weight of approximately 100.12 g/mol. This compound typically appears as a pale yellow liquid with a faint, sweet odor. Nitrosomorpholine is known for its potential carcinogenic properties, which have raised health concerns, particularly in occupational settings where exposure may occur. It is soluble in water and organic solvents, making it versatile in various chemical applications. Due to its toxicological profile, handling nitrosomorpholine requires strict safety precautions to minimize exposure. Additionally, it is important to note that nitrosamines, including nitrosomorpholine, can form in certain conditions from the reaction of secondary amines with nitrosating agents, highlighting the need for careful management in environments where such reactions may occur.
